Ultra Mode isn't simply "AI thinking longer." The key difference is:

Ultra allows one lead AI to organize multiple other AIs to work together.

1. Ultra Mode is not a new model

This is the most common misconception.

When you see names like GPT-5.6 Sol, Claude Opus, Claude Sonnet — those are models, which you can think of as the "brain" of the AI.

Levels like Low, Medium, High, XHigh, Max — primarily determine how much computational resources the AI dedicates to reasoning.

Ultra operates at a different layer entirely.

Think of it this way:

Model ↓ Reasoning / Thinking ↓ Tools ↓ Agent ↓ Multi-Agent Orchestration ↓ Ultra

Ultra doesn't necessarily replace the "brain." It changes how that brain organizes work.

Ultra Mode — AI Working as a Team

Ultra fundamentally changes the work structure.

AI Lead │ analyzes the problem │ ┌────────────┼────────────┐ ↓ ↓ ↓ Agent A Agent B Agent C │ │ │ └────────────┼────────────┘ ↓ verify results ↓ synthesize ↓ final answer

The lead AI now acts like a team lead. It doesn't necessarily do all the work itself. It can delegate parts to different subagents.

3. Ultra is more than just a "workflow"

You could call Ultra a workflow, but that's not entirely accurate.

Traditional workflows are pre-designed:

Step A ↓ Step B ↓ Step C ↓ Step D

Ultra is far more flexible. The AI receives a task and then decides on its own how to execute it:

Receive request ↓ Analyze the problem ↓ Can it be broken down? ↓ Create subtasks ↓ Assign to subagents ↓ Run some tasks in parallel ↓ Collect results ↓ Identify gaps ↓ Research more if needed ↓ Verify ↓ Synthesize

Meaning the workflow can be dynamically created based on the problem.

📌 Technical term

If you need a more precise term: Dynamic multi-agent orchestration.

But for everyday users, you can simply call it: AI working as a team.

4. Real-world example: Market analysis

Let's say you ask:

"Analyze the Vietnamese electric vehicle market, competitors, pricing, battery technology, consumer trends, and provide forecasts."

How would a regular AI (Normal/Thinking) handle this?

It would do everything sequentially:

Research market → find competitors → check prices → study technology → analyze customer behavior → synthesize analysis → write report

Everything done by one AI, one step at a time. If one part takes longer, the entire process slows down.

How does Ultra Mode do it differently?

Ultra splits the work across multiple AIs simultaneously:

🔍 Agent A — Market Size

Researches market size, growth rate, and revenue of Vietnam's EV market.

🏢 Agent B — Competing Brands

Analyzes VinFast, Tesla, BYD, and other competitors in the market.

💰 Agent C — Pricing and Products

Compares pricing, specifications, and features across vehicle lines.

🔋 Agent D — Battery Technology

Evaluates battery technology, lifespan, and fast-charging capabilities.

👥 Agent E — Consumer Behavior

Studies purchasing trends, decision factors, and user feedback.

✅ Agent F — Data Verification

Checks information reliability, finds references, and identifies inconsistencies.

Relatively independent parts are done at the same time. Then the lead AI synthesizes everything into a complete report.

Speed: Parallel work is much faster than sequential execution.
Quality: Each agent focuses deeply on one area, resulting in more detailed and accurate output.
Verification: A dedicated verification agent catches errors before final synthesis.

5. When should you use Ultra Mode?

You don't need Ultra for everything. Here's a quick guide:

Level When to use Example
Normal Simple tasks, no complex reasoning needed Translation, email writing, summarizing, basic Q&A
Thinking Needs deep reasoning, complex logic Analysis, planning, debugging, system design
Ultra Large tasks with multiple independent parts, needs multiple perspectives Market research, large project analysis, comprehensive product evaluation
⚠️ Note: Ultra Mode typically consumes more resources and takes longer. Use it only when truly needed — not for every question.
